- Your dog must be tattooed or microchipped.
- The site does not accept breeds/crossbreeds listed in the Dangerous Dogs Act (i.e. Pit Bull Terrier, Japanese Tosa, Dogo Argentino, and Fila Brasileiro).
- Group bookings of 4 or more units (e.g. tent, touring caravan, motorhome or accommodation hire) travelling together are not permitted via Pitchup.com.
- Group bookings of 4 or more adults are not permitted (couples and immediate family members excepted).
- Single-sex bookings of 4 or more people (couples and immediate family members excepted) are not permitted via Pitchup.com.
- No hen/stag parties permitted via Pitchup.com.
- Guests under the age of 18 are not allowed on site.
- Commercial vehicles (vehicles used for work-related purposes, carrying goods or fare-paying passengers) and sign-written vehicles are not permitted on site.
- Tents are not accepted at this park.
- A cable measuring at least 12 metres is needed for the electric hook-ups.
- Protective masks must be worn at all times in common areas.
- This is a quiet site: no music is allowed.

Liked: Great little site for us as not far from home. A very quiet site with quite a few permanent pitches And adults only which is not a bad thing with no one running around at 7-30 in the morning. Lol Liked the fact you get the gate code and pitch number in advance although a site map would help navigate the site. It’s not a big site and I have seen people moan about the distance to toilets but this is not too far and while not a big amenity block, never had to que and all was clean and tidy. Can I pick fault, no I can’t apart from the envy I had for some of the 5th wheelers on site. Some people say the personall interaction is missing but personally I like that as I’m away with the other half for the weekend and not the site. Market Bosworth is a nice walk in via the country park and has a few pubs, cafes and posher eateries. An enjoyable weekend had.

Liked: The pitches were huge and level and the site was lovely and clean. And it was only a 20 minute walk into Market Bosworth across the coutry park.
Disliked: When we arrived there was only 1 shower available in the mens and womens, which we thought might be an issue, however the following day a second shower was made available. Luckily as the site was quite quiet and appears to mainly cater for very large long stay motorhomes and caravans this didn't become an issue. There are no rubbish bins! We looked everywhere but couldn't find any bins for our rubbish when we left. Over priced. At £30 per night for a grass EHU I thought this was very expensive, even if the pitches were huge. And they wanted extra for WiFi!! Not impressed.
